Cailey Parsells had her best week at the plate this season in a pair of doubleheader sweeps over Southwestern Christian University and Southwestern Assemblies of God University. Parsells went 8-for-11 with 2 doubles, 3 triples, 5 RBI’s, 5 runs, and 2 stolen bases. She notched a 1.455 slugging percentage and reached base 75% of the time. Parsells was 8-for-8 at the plate over the final three games. She tied the program’s single season triples record with 4 and became the first player in program history to steal 30 bases in a season.
Stats on the week: .727 AVG, 2 doubles, 3 triples, 5 runs, 5 RBI’s, 1.455 SLG
